Climate Considerations

Austin’s climate is characterized by hot summers and mild winters, making it suitable for growing junipers. These trees require well-drained soil and ample sunlight. When choosing a juniper bonsai Monrovia, ensure it is compatible with the US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 8, which is common in Austin and surrounding areas.

Selecting the Perfect Juniper Bonsai Monrovia

When seeking a juniper bonsai Monrovia in Austin, consider visiting local nurseries and garden centers that specialize in bonsai and coniferous plants. Look for a healthy juniper bonsai Monrovia with vibrant green needles and a sturdy, well-formed trunk. Avoid plants with yellow or browning foliage, as this may indicate stress or disease.

Tips for Buying a Juniper Bonsai Monrovia

1. Local Expertise: Seek advice from knowledgeable staff at local nurseries, as they can offer guidance specific to Austin’s climate and soil conditions.

2. Examining the Plant: Carefully inspect the juniper bonsai Monrovia for any signs of damage, pests, or irregular growth. A healthy plant should exhibit vigorous growth and a balanced structure.

3. Root Health: Check the root system of the bonsai to ensure it is well-contained within the pot and displays a healthy, fibrous structure.

4. Size and Shape: Select a juniper bonsai Monrovia that suits your landscaping needs in terms of size, shape, and overall aesthetic appeal.

Planting and Care in Austin, Texas

Once you have selected and purchased your juniper bonsai Monrovia, it’s essential to provide proper care to ensure its long-term health and vitality in Austin’s climate.

Planting Guidelines

1. Soil Preparation: Use well-draining soil suitable for junipers and ensure proper drainage to prevent waterlogged roots, which can be detrimental to the plant’s health.

2. Sunlight Exposure: Position the bonsai where it can receive ample sunlight, as junipers thrive in full sun to partial shade. Consider Austin’s sun exposure patterns when choosing the ideal location for your juniper bonsai Monrovia.

3. Watering: Establish a regular watering routine, allowing the soil to dry slightly between waterings. Be mindful of Austin’s seasonal variations and adjust your watering schedule accordingly.

Maintenance and Pruning

1. Fertilization: Use a balanced fertilizer formulated for bonsai and apply it according to the manufacturer’s instructions, taking into account Austin’s growing season and climate.

2. Pruning and Shaping: Regularly prune and shape the juniper bonsai Monrovia to maintain its desired form and encourage healthy growth. Consider the unique landscaping aesthetics of Austin when shaping your bonsai.

3. Winter Protection: During colder months, protect the juniper bonsai Monrovia from freezing temperatures, which may occur sporadically in Austin. Consider providing additional insulation or relocating the plant indoors if necessary.
